OpenSeadragon est une visionneuse d'image qui peut adapter à tous vos projets.
Par défaut, il inclut le support pour l'image zoom, panoramique drag-and-drop, auto-centrage, et divers boutons pour commander le widget. Tous ces éléments peuvent être activés ou désactivés, en fonction des besoins de chaque projet.
D'autres fonctionnalités intéressantes incluses sont des raccourcis clavier, support pour la rotation d'image, mettant en évidence des zones d'image spéciales, infobulles d'image, des superpositions, et un mode de débogage.
En plus des images simples, les développeurs peuvent afficher plusieurs images pour créer une galerie entière image et même OSM ou Google Maps.
Démos et docs sont inclus avec le package de téléchargement
Ce qui est nouveau dans cette version:.
- Correction de problèmes avec contraintes zoom / pan avec certains réglages extrêmes
- Correction d'un problème entraînant le navigateur pour écraser sur iOS
Ce qui est nouveau dans la version 2.1.0:
- nouvelle source de tuile ajoutée pour des images simples: ImageTileSource
- Optimisé ajoutant un grand nombre d'articles dans le monde avec collectionMode
- Registres comme un module AMD, si possible,
- Ajout & quot; carrelage chargé & quot; événement sur le spectateur permettant de modifier une tuile avant qu'il ne soit marqué prêt à tirer
- Ajout & quot; carreau déchargé & quot; événement sur le spectateur qui permet de libérer de la mémoire n'a alloué sur une tuile
- Ajout événement "tuiles-failed charge '
- Ajout supplémentaire coordonne les méthodes de conversion à TiledImage
- Ajout d'une option preserveImageSizeOnResize
- collectionColumns ajouté en tant que paramètre de configuration
- Ajout d'une option dans addTiledImage pour remplacer tiledImage à l'index
- Ajout autoRefigureSizes drapeau mondial pour l'optimisation des réarrangements de masse
- Vous pouvez maintenant modifier les marges viewport après le spectateur est créé
- Ajout d'un patch pour aider à ralentir les appareils de défilement qui tirent trop vite
- vacillantes fixe avec useCanvas = false lorsque aucun cache est utilisé
- 'display: none' ne se fait remettre sur les superpositions lors de tirage
- Une meilleure signalisation des erreurs pour des échecs de chargement de tuiles
- Ajout XDomainRequest comme méthode de repli pour les demandes de ajax si XMLHttpRequest échoue (pour IE & # x3C; 10)
tuiles
Commentaires non trouvées